Low Carb Breakfast Burrito With Eggs, Avocado, And Sauteed Vegetables Recipe

  • Total Time: 15 minutes
  • Yield: 2 1x

Ingredients

Main Protein:

  • 4 large eggs
  • 1/2 cup shredded cheese (cheddar, mozzarella, or your choice)

Vegetables and Fats:

  • 1/2 avocado, sliced
  • 1/2 cup bell peppers, diced
  • 1/4 cup onions, diced
  • 1/4 cup mushrooms, sliced
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il or butter

Optional and Seasoning Ingredients:

  • 1 tablespoon heavy cream or milk
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 2 low-carb tortillas (or lettuce wraps for an ultra-low-carb option)
  • 1 tablespoon salsa or hot sauce

Instructions

  1. Vigorously blend eggs with cream, seasoning with salt and pepper until well-incorporated and slightly frothy.
  2. Warm olive oil in a skillet over moderate temperature, introducing diced onions, vibrant bell peppers, and sliced mushrooms. Sauté until vegetables transform into tender, slightly caramelized morsels, approximately 4 minutes.
  3. Transfer sautéed vegetables to a separate plate, maintaining pan temperature.
  4. Melt butter in the identical skillet, creating a silky coating across the surface.
  5. Gently cascade whisked eggs into the buttered pan, using a soft spatula to create delicate, creamy curds over low heat.
  6. Construct the burrito by layering fluffy scrambled eggs onto a low-carb tortilla, arranging sautéed vegetable medley atop the eggs.
  7. Embellish with creamy avocado slices and sprinkle shredded cheese for added richness.
  8. Optional: Enhance flavor profile with a drizzle of zesty salsa or fiery hot sauce.
  9. Carefully fold tortilla edges, crafting a secure, compact wrap that encapsulates all ingredients.
  10. Serve immediately while ingredients remain warm and textures are perfectly balanced.

Notes

  • Swap traditional tortillas with large lettuce leaves for a completely carb-free, fresh wrap alternative.
  • Use egg whites or a combination of whole eggs and egg whites to reduce overall fat content while maintaining protein levels.
  • Experiment with different low-carb vegetables like zucchini, spinach, or asparagus to add variety and nutritional diversity to your breakfast burrito.
  • Select aged or hard cheeses like parmesan or aged cheddar which naturally have fewer carbohydrates compared to softer cheese varieties.
